Transaction 5144d3ff731f428d734918cd12ee0368488c11e5ab43c61e81b9ce8721ca6842

2 Input
2 Outputs
  • 5144d3ff731f428d734918cd12ee0368488c11e5ab43c61e81b9ce8721ca6842:0
  • value  384619
    address  341ELPh2RK63wUaHW4nJQPKr5hWNR8dfqp
  • 5144d3ff731f428d734918cd12ee0368488c11e5ab43c61e81b9ce8721ca6842:1
  • value  1758590
    address  35paaFgK15hXdL2qaSaAVKvfWsJw26w5bL